The eligibility criteria for admission to Kamla Nehru Institute of Technology for B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ering are:
- Students must have passed 10+2 examination with physics, chemistry & mathematics with a minimum of 45% marks (for SC/ST 40%).
- Students who have cleared JEE Main may opt the Institute through JEE Main counseling.
- For Direct Admission: To avail the seats of management quota student must have passed 10+2 examination with physics, chemistry & mathematics with a minimum of 45% marks (for SC/ST 40%).

The fee for B.Tech in Computer Science and Engineering at Kamla Nehru Institute of Technology is paid annually, with a total annual fee of Rs. 61,200/- and a total fee of Rs. 2.45 Lacs for the entire course.

The admission criteria for B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ering at Kamla Nehru Institute of Technology includes eligibility through JEE Main, direct admission with a minimum of 45% marks in 10+2 examination with physics, chemistry, and mathematics, or lateral entry with a Diploma or B.Sc. (Maths) degree with a minimum of 50% marks. Required documents for admission include marks statements, date of birth certificate, provisional certificate, character certificate, photographs, AADHAR Card copy, and PAN Card copy.
